should i replace J tube?
 
I noticed a puddle of oil just under the Air / Oil separator and most probably the culprit is the J tube. I noticed that the O ring was thorn. Should I try to find some replacement O rings or should I just buy a new J tube?

jdraupp 04-21-2016 03:53 PM

You would likely have a vacuum leak and idle issues probably accompanied by a CEL if this was the culprit. I mean, it's cheap enough you can do it easily. But I'd think if it was an issue you'd have other symptoms.

The Radium King 04-22-2016 07:10 AM

probably the oil fill tube that runs from the trunk to the engine - it has a joiner right at the aos that will drip oil if you are chucking the car around.
